U.S. foreclosure filings fell 19 percent in January, compared to the same month a year ago, but will likely rise in the coming months, according to a report released Wednesday by RealtyTrac.
There were 210,941 foreclosure filings — default notices, scheduled auctions or bank reposessions — nationwide in January 2012, a 3 percent increase from December. California cities and Las Vegas continue to see a large number of foreclosures.
RealtyTrac, like many economists, predicts that the number of foreclosures will rise again now that the lawsuit against five major banks filed by state attorneys general over foreclosure fraud was settled last week.
